Output 034096ae8faa6915f380cce5e18a945f8e2d1fce14d204ddd80ceccfd6d34072:10

value
40499991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8838f839974e5354a43b500c56b12ea6b50f5c34 OP_EQUAL
address
MLKSNqaP7mGudLZU42kozqbRkjXFGZMCXt
transaction
034096ae8faa6915f380cce5e18a945f8e2d1fce14d204ddd80ceccfd6d34072
spent
true